Lon Po Po: A Red-Riding Hood Story from China starring BD Wong has a Not Rated rating, a runtime of about 14 min, and a scheduled release date of January 10th, 2006.
Let’s set the scene for you... Here's the plot: "In this Chinese version of the classic fairy tale, a mother leaves her three children home alone while she goes to visit their grandmother. When the children are visited by a wolf, pretending to be their Po Po, or granny, they let him in the house, but ultimately are not fooled by his deep voice and hairy face. Combining ancient Chinese panel art techniques with a contemporary palette of watercolors and pastels, this powerful story brings lessons about strangers, trust and courage to a new generation."
